Fluxx is hiring a technical Implementation Specialist to play a critical role on the Customer Onboarding Team. We are looking for candidates with 3-5 years of professional experience, which includes a combination of customer-facing, project-based, and technical implementation work. The primary responsibilities of the SaaS Implementation Specialist include: 

1) becoming a Fluxx product expert, 

2) translating the customer’s business needs into Fluxx solutions leveraging platform functionality, 

3) configuring the system based on the customer’s needs, 

4) executing data migrations (if scoped and in partnership with Data Specialist) and,

5) creating and maintaining a strong project timeline and executing against the scope

This is a full-time exempt and remote position. Candidates must be located in the United States. 

About Fluxx:

At Fluxx, our mission is to be the leading collaborative grantmaking platform in our global communities. 

We believe in building technology that drives a positive impact in our world. Our platform helps foundations and agencies streamline the grantmaking process, making it easier to get funding to those who need it to support their mission. We are driven to help facilitate change through our solutions that automate grantmaking for organizations all over the world.  Over the past decade, Fluxx has built a boundary-pushing community of 330+ grantmakers who work with more than 150,000 nonprofits worldwide who are responsible for transacting $15.7B in investments last year alone! 

What you will be doing:

  • Manage the implementation of Fluxx software for multiple customers concurrently, delivering within the project scope and timeline deadlines
  • Ability to navigate and balance competing priorities across multiple projects
  • Collect and confirm product configuration requirements using blueprints, templates,  prototyping, business analysis, and process analysis to deliver grant management solution configuration to meet those requirements
  • When appropriate, leverage knowledge of programming languages to meet customer’s requirements and enhance their experience of the platform
  • Utilize stellar project management skills and techniques to ensure scope and timelines are adhered to and the customer has a satisfactory experience during their implementation and beyond
  • Oversee the data migration within the project to both effectively communicate the process and model as well as complete the technical elements: data readiness, execution, iteration. 
  • Troubleshoot and facilitate issue resolution, proactively collaborating with team members of other departments (Product, Support, Engineering, etc.) 
  • Educate customers on how to use purchased software system and personalized system features
  • Communicate with different levels of management regarding project status and needs. Ability to discuss these solutions with both the technical and business community.
  • Be a great communicator, meaning you understand the significance and appropriate use of tone and mediums based on circumstance and audience.
  • Be ready, willing, and able to track and document everything that happens on the project, then report on it like clockwork to the project team and stakeholders.

What you bring to the team:

  • 3-5 years of professional experience: 1) configuring software solutions, 2) eliciting customer requirements/user stories, and 3) business process analysis 
  • Strong familiarity with agile project management principles, tools, and techniques. Previous project management experience required.
  • Be comfortable presenting technical information and leading customer meetings with professionalism and integrity 
  • Very strong analytical skills and the expertise to translate user scenarios (or business requirements) into technical solutions
  • Experience and/or understanding of data migration processes and principles 
  • Detail-oriented with the ability to multitask, meet deadlines, and quickly process information  
  • A track record of being a team player and leader with strong interpersonal skills and a talent for collaboration
  • Be a problem-solver who has a demonstrated ability to overcome challenges with creative solutions
  • Be a self-motivated, independent worker and thinker with a positive attitude
  • Familiarity with grant management processes is a huge a plus
  • Familiarity with CRM and grantmaking software is also a plus (especially Fluxx Grantmaker) 
  • Familiarity with scripting skills, including CSS/HTML/Liquid/Ruby 
  • Passionate about Fluxx’s vision to become THE company that changes philanthropy forever

Salary:

The expected annual base salary for this role is $100,000 - 108,000.  The base pay range is subject to change in the future. 

The successful candidate’s starting salary will be determined based on, but not limited to, (a) location, (b) individual candidate skills and qualifications, and (c) individual candidate experience. 

Fluxx is committed to fair and equitable compensation practices. We take a market-based approach to pay which may vary depending on your location. Locations are categorized into one of three zones based on a cost of labor index for that geographic location and our compensation philosophy.

What you need to know about the San Francisco Tech Scene

San Francisco and the surrounding Bay Area attracts more startup funding than any other region in the world. Home to Stanford University and UC Berkeley, leading VC firms and several of the world’s most valuable companies, the Bay Area is the place to go for anyone looking to make it big in the tech industry. That said, San Francisco has a lot to offer beyond technology thanks to a thriving art and music scene, excellent food and a short drive to several of the country’s most beautiful recreational areas.

Key Facts About San Francisco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 365,500; 13.9%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Google, Apple, Salesforce, Meta
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, fintech, consumer technology, software
  • Funding Landscape: $50.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Sequoia Capital, Andreessen Horowitz, Bessemer Venture Partners, Greylock Partners, Khosla Ventures, Kleiner Perkins
  • Research Centers and Universities: Stanford University; University of California, Berkeley; University of San Francisco; Santa Clara University; Ames Research Center; Center for AI Safety; California Institute for Regenerative Medicine
